Transaction 43bcd105444a02a95c7c38138c79987962e60e35f2dece7717f2cdca58811bf8
1 Input
1 Output
-
43bcd105444a02a95c7c38138c79987962e60e35f2dece7717f2cdca58811bf8:0
- value
- 1286769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ce22781b3ebd446d28c734a4e28d4b61911a7d7 OP_EQUAL
- address
- 34KjmPjkBpGy9x8yixRjtEW7nMccBAhr53